How many meaningful four-letter English words can be formed using the first, second, third, and fifth letters of the word "TRAVEL" (when counted from left to right), using each letter only once in each word?

A1

B2

C3

D5

Answer:

C. 3

Read Explanation:

The letters available are:

  • T (1st)

  • R (2nd)

  • A (3rd)

  • E (5th)

Using all four letters exactly once, the meaningful English words are:

  1. RATE

  2. TARE

  3. TEAR

So, the total number of meaningful four-letter words is:

3
